“…According to the T 2 , the fitted continuous exponential curves could be roughly divided into three parts: T 21 (0.01–10 ms), T 22 (10–100 ms) and T 23 (100–10,000 ms). The areas of these three components represent the contents of tightly bound, softly bound and free water, respectively [ 40 ]. For the central and mesocarp sites of kiwifruit, the relaxation peak of T 23 on other sampling days shifted to the right compared to day 0, indicating that the water activity increased during postharvest storage at low temperature.…”

“…T 21 (0.01–10 ms), T 22 (10–100 ms), and T 23 (10–1000 ms) represent tightly bound water with the carbon skeleton, immobile water combined with sugar or other large molecules, and free water, respectively. Studies have shown that water in the cells that binds to the carbon skeleton has no fluidity and short relaxation time (Younas et al, 2021). As shown in Figure 6a, T 22 , with the largest peak area, is the main water in sugared orange peels, and this part of the water in the sugared orange peels is the water combined with sugar or Hydrocolloids.…”

“…MRI, which can transform the signals generated by H proton magnetic resonance in the material into images through spatial coding technology, reflects the water distribution of sugared orange peels (Younas et al, 2021). The brighter the magnetic resonance image, the stronger the magnetic resonance signal and the higher the proton density (Kong et al, 2018).…”

“…More specifically, T 2 band could be further characterized into three peaks of the three different water states, as shown in Figure 1. They represented bound water T 21 (0.01-10 ms), immobilized water T 22 (10-100 ms), and free water T 23 (100-1000 ms), respectively [34]. The three peak intensities are evaluated by peak areas by A 21 , A 22 and A 23 , which correspond to the content of each water component.…”
